Episode: Val McDermid on anger, ageing β and an unlikely "cure" for menopause
Description: Dubbed the Queen of Crime, Val McDermid has written 35 books (she thinks, but sheβs stopped counting), sold over 17million copies and been translated into 40 languages. At the vanguard of female crimewriters, sheβs created countless female sleuths but is probably best known for one of her male ones - Dr Tony Hill of the TV series Wire In The Blood. She also created Traces the BBC series aired earlier this year starring Martin (Line of Duty) Compston.Now 65, sheβs gone back to her youth.
